Output dc58a63eb4ad17eac0397eddecf810b341a3fd75464c09310a631fda2bdc8ab4:5

value
610154
script pubkey
OP_0 OP_PUSHBYTES_32 e96d34b8124764f8070fda0f1df4c906b8884731d9ca379acabcfd22c153a8d1
address
bc1qa9knfwqjgaj0spc0mg83maxfq6ugs3e3m89r0xk2hn7j9s2n4rgsp0snja
transaction
dc58a63eb4ad17eac0397eddecf810b341a3fd75464c09310a631fda2bdc8ab4
confirmations
2269
spent
true